Go First to restart Srinagar-Sharjah flights in next few days

Go First to restart Srinagar-Sharjah flights in next few days

Go First on Friday got the bilateral rights to operate Srinagar-Sharjah flights which the airline said it will restart in the next few days. Go First had stopped operating the Srinagar-Sharjah flights on March 27 due to the lack of bilateral rights, which are granted under air services agreements signed between two countries to operate … Read more

Revival plan approved for Jet Airways, but will the airline fly again?

After being out of action for over a year, a ray of hope has emerged for bankrupt airline Jet Airways and its existing employees. A panel of the airline’s creditors recently approved a potential revival plan after almost 17 months.
